A quick definition of sanae mentis:

Term: SANAE MENTIS

Definition: Sanae mentis means that someone is of sound mind and is not mentally ill. It is a term used in the past in legal contexts to determine if someone was capable of making decisions or entering into contracts.

A more thorough explanation:

Definition: Sanae mentis (san-ee men-tis) is a Latin term used in law to describe someone who is of sound mind or sane mind.

Examples:

  • Before signing a legal document, the person must be of sanae mentis.
  • The court declared the defendant not guilty by reason of insanity, as they were not of sanae mentis at the time of the crime.

The first example illustrates how the term is used to ensure that a person is mentally capable of making a legal decision. The second example shows how the term can be used in a legal context to determine a person's guilt or innocence based on their mental state.
